cPanel Webmail Login From a New Device Scam: Fake Security Alert Exposed

A new-device notification deserves attention when it concerns webmail. Unfortunately, the same concern can be manufactured by someone who wants the account password.

This message borrows the appearance of a routine hosting alert. Its most important clues appear only after the sender and destination receive equal scrutiny.

Overview

A Suspicious Login Alert With a Precise Time

The cPanel Webmail Login From a New Device email scam says somebody accessed the recipient’s webmail account from an unfamiliar device.

The examined message used the subject “Webmail: We detected a suspicious login.” It placed the alleged event at 7:46:45 AM.

That second-by-second timestamp lends authority. It resembles the exact telemetry a real security platform might record after a successful sign-in.

The email tells recipients to do nothing if they recognize the activity. Everyone else is directed toward a “Review Your Account” button.

The Review Link Is the Trap

The button does not lead to a protected cPanel session. It opens a fake Webmail page built to collect an address and password.

The observed destination included a misspelling resembling “review activites.” Small errors like that matter because genuine account portals use controlled, consistent domains.

  • The alert arrives without a matching notification inside webmail.
  • A precise time makes a vague claim appear logged.
  • The recipient gets only 24 hours to respond.
  • The sender address is not an established hosting contact.
  • The review button leaves the genuine control-panel domain.
  • The landing page asks for the full mailbox password.
  • The misspelled destination is easy to overlook.

cPanel is a real hosting-control platform and is not responsible for this campaign. Criminals imitate familiar webmail language to gain trust.

What Criminals Can Do With Webmail Credentials

Webmail often belongs to a custom business domain. Access may expose customers, suppliers, quotations, invoices, support tickets, and internal discussions.

A criminal can study how the organization communicates before sending a tailored payment request. That later fraud may look far more convincing than the original lure.

Hosting accounts sometimes reuse or connect credentials across services. The attacker may test the stolen password against control panels, file transfer, and billing portals.

The operation is credential phishing, not a legitimate security review. The “new device” exists only to push the victim into authenticating on hostile infrastructure.

How the cPanel Webmail New Device Scam Works

Step 1: The Email Mimics a Familiar Security Notice

The campaign opens with restrained language rather than an extravagant claim. New sign-in alerts are common, so the message does not initially seem unusual.

It addresses the service generically as Webmail. That wording lets one template target thousands of independently hosted domains using different providers.

The sender avoids naming an actual hosting plan, server, organization, or administrator. Specific account facts would be difficult to invent accurately.

Instead, the email relies on the recipient’s existing concern about unauthorized access. The reader supplies the missing context.

Step 2: The Timestamp Simulates Security Evidence

The alleged login occurred at 7:46:45 AM. Including seconds suggests that an automated monitoring system recorded the event precisely.

Yet a timestamp alone proves nothing. The warning may omit a usable date, time zone, browser, IP address, or device identifier.

Real alerts usually let customers compare those details with activity shown inside the account. This message offers no independently reachable record.

Even when a phishing email includes an IP address, the value may be random, reserved, or copied. Every clue must agree with the real portal.

Step 3: A 24-Hour Expiration Encourages Immediate Action

The button is presented as a temporary security link that expires within 24 hours. That deadline makes delaying the review feel unsafe.

Expiration language also discourages asking a hosting company for help. Victims may believe support will respond after their only recovery opportunity disappears.

A genuine provider can be reached independently, and a compromised account can be secured through the normal portal. Safety never depends exclusively on one email button.

The message’s conditional phrasing feels reasonable: ignore it if the activity was yours. That small detail helps the fabricated alert sound operational.

Step 4: The Review Button Opens an Impostor Domain

The visible words “Review Your Account” conceal the address underneath. The recipient sees a security action, while the browser visits an unrelated site.

In the analyzed campaign, the destination imitated webmail and used a suspicious spelling in its host. It was not the server that normally handled the mailbox.

Phishing domains may contain terms such as webmail, review, secure, account, or activity. Keywords are inexpensive and confer no official relationship.

The registered domain should match the provider’s established address. A plausible path on the wrong host remains the wrong destination.

Illustrative counterfeit Webmail Account Review login page on a fictional domain

Step 5: The Counterfeit Panel Requests the Password

The landing page resembles a clean hosting interface. A shield icon, white card, and blue button reproduce the visual expectations of an account-security workflow.

It asks for the mailbox address and password to review activity. Those fields do not connect the visitor to cPanel or the legitimate hosting company.

Submitting the form transfers the data to the operator. A loading animation or generic error may appear while the information is stored elsewhere.

Some kits prefill the address from the link. Personalization of that kind means the URL carried the email value, not that the site verified ownership.

Step 6: The Intruder Turns One Mailbox Into Leverage

Successful access lets the attacker search for billing messages, password resets, domain-renewal notices, and conversations involving money.

The criminal may register forwarding rules, create application passwords, or keep a session active. Those footholds can survive an incomplete cleanup.

A compromised custom-domain address carries organizational authority. Fraudulent requests from that address can reach customers, contractors, or other employees.

If the credential was reused, the attack expands. Hosting panels, domain registrars, and remote administration tools become especially valuable targets.

How to Verify a Webmail Login Alert

Check Activity From the Known Control Panel

Use the bookmark or hosting dashboard you already trust. Navigate to account security and recent sessions without touching the email’s button.

Look for a login matching the stated time, allowing for your actual time zone. Compare the device, browser, IP address, and approximate location.

If no corresponding event appears, capture the warning and report it. Do not sign in repeatedly through the questionable route.

Identify Who Actually Operates the Mailbox

cPanel software may power the service, but your host, employer, or administrator manages the account. Their verified contact details matter.

Compare the sender with earlier billing, support, or maintenance notices. Hosting providers generally send from stable domains with recognizable ticket references.

For workplace mail, ask the internal technical team. An outside message claiming to be “Webmail Security” may bypass the organization’s established support identity.

Read the Destination Character by Character

Preview the link and inspect the hostname. Misspellings such as “activites” instead of “activities” are strong warnings, especially inside a security portal.

Watch for added words, unusual endings, substituted letters, and domains that place the real brand only in a subdomain.

A valid certificate does not correct a deceptive address. Encryption protects the connection to whoever owns the impostor site.

Illustrative expanded webmail alert revealing failed authentication and a misspelled fictional link

Contact Hosting Support Outside the Message

Open a ticket from the provider’s normal dashboard or use a telephone number on a known invoice. Describe the alert without relying on its reply address.

Support can confirm whether the notice format is theirs and inspect the login logs. They can also secure the account if a genuine intrusion occurred.

Never send a password to support by email. Legitimate technicians can reset access or verify records without learning the customer’s existing secret.

What to Do If You Fell Victim to the cPanel Webmail Login Scam

A prompt response can contain the incident. Begin with the mailbox, then consider every service where the same credential may have been used.

  1. Stop interacting with the imitation panel.

    Close it and do not test additional credentials. Record the alert subject, sender, destination, and the time you submitted information.

    Hosting customers should retain relevant screenshots and headers. Those details help the provider identify the kit and remove similar messages.

  2. Change the password through the genuine host.

    Open the trusted control panel directly and set a unique replacement. If access fails, begin recovery from the provider’s official support page.

    Do not use a password derived from the old one. Attackers often test predictable variations after a reset.

  3. Protect connected hosting services.

    Review cPanel, domain registrar, file-transfer, database, billing, and site-administration accounts. Replace any credential that matched or closely resembled the exposed password.

    Check whether contact emails, nameservers, authorized keys, or recovery options changed. Website control can be more damaging than mailbox access alone.

  4. End sessions and inspect mailbox persistence.

    Sign out unfamiliar devices, revoke application passwords, and remove unrecognized connected applications. Then inspect forwarding, filters, aliases, and delegates.

    Search sent and deleted mail for messages you did not create. Hidden replies may show which contacts the intruder targeted.

  5. Add strong multifactor authentication.

    Enable a passkey, hardware key, or authenticator application on both mail and hosting accounts. Protect the registrar separately when possible.

    Review backup codes and recovery contacts. Remove old telephone numbers or addresses that an attacker could exploit later.

  6. Examine devices if anything was downloaded.

  7. Notify the provider and exposed correspondents.

    Ask the host to review authentication logs and preserve evidence. Tell customers or coworkers if fraudulent mail left your address.

    Contact banks immediately when payment instructions or financial records were accessible. Preserve case numbers and document each remedial action.

Why Hosting-Account Phishing Is Especially Serious

A personal inbox is valuable, but a custom-domain mailbox can represent an entire business. Its address often signals authority to outsiders.

Hosting correspondence may reveal renewal dates, registrar details, support PINs, server names, and administrative usernames. Those fragments support more focused attacks.

Website reset messages can also arrive there. The intruder may request a new administrator password and intercept the response.

Small businesses are attractive because one person may control email, billing, domains, and the website. A single credential can bridge several systems.

The fake new-device warning reverses the roles. The victim believes they are excluding an intruder while actually supplying that intruder with access.

Practical Defenses for Hosted Email

Use separate passwords for mailbox users, hosting administration, domain registration, and website management. Separation prevents one captured secret from opening every layer.

Require multifactor authentication on privileged accounts. Limit administrator access to people who genuinely need it, and remove dormant users.

Configure authentication records for your domain and monitor failures. These controls cannot stop every impersonation, but they improve filtering and investigation.

Teach staff the verified route to webmail. A bookmarked address is more dependable than searching or following an urgent message.

Create alerts for forwarding-rule changes, new application passwords, unfamiliar countries, and excessive failed logins. Early warnings shrink an attacker’s working time.

Keep reliable website and mailbox backups under separate credentials. Recovery becomes much safer when a compromised hosting account cannot delete every copy.

Establish a verbal confirmation process for financial requests arriving by email. An attacker reading existing conversations can imitate tone and timing convincingly.

Finally, make reporting straightforward. The employee who questions a polished notice is providing useful intelligence, not creating unnecessary work.

Hosting customers should keep provider ownership records current. An outdated recovery address can turn a small mailbox incident into a long account-recovery dispute.

Administrators should record which users need access to DNS, backups, databases, and mail. Narrow privileges prevent one compromised identity from controlling every service.

Quarterly restore tests are equally important. A backup that nobody has successfully restored cannot be treated as dependable protection during a hosting emergency.

These measures also clarify responsibility. When users know who manages webmail, a nameless external security team loses much of its persuasive power.

Frequently Asked Questions

Was there really a webmail login at 7:46:45 AM?

The email’s timestamp is not proof. Compare it with recent activity inside the genuine control panel and account for the displayed time zone.

Is cPanel responsible for the suspicious message?

No. The campaign imitates cPanel-style webmail language. The legitimate software company did not authorize the unrelated password-collection page.

Why does the alert say the link expires in 24 hours?

The deadline adds pressure and makes independent support seem too slow. A real provider remains reachable through its normal dashboard after an email link expires.

Does HTTPS mean the review page is safe?

No. HTTPS encrypts traffic between you and the site. It does not confirm that the site belongs to your host or treats credentials honestly.

What if the message time matches a real login?

Secure the account through the official portal and contact the host. A real event can coexist with a phishing message, so avoid the embedded button.

Should I change my cPanel password too?

Yes, if it matched or resembled the submitted mailbox password. Review the hosting account for unauthorized changes and enable separate multifactor protection.

The Bottom Line

The cPanel Webmail Login From a New Device scam invents suspicious activity, supplies a precise time, and hides a credential collector behind account review.

Use the known hosting dashboard, examine the domain closely, and contact the real provider. A security alert should never dictate an unfamiliar route to your password.
